Three types of electrical discharge machine: die sinking edm, wire cut edm, drill edm

Types of electrical discharge machining: die sinking edm, wire cut edm, drill edm


The working principle of EDM is to rely on electric corrosion to erode excess metal during discharge between the machine tool and the workpiece (positive and negative electrodes), so as to achieve the processing method of the size, shape and appearance quality of the workpiece.


Machining electrodes: Generally, electro-corrosion-resistant materials with good conductivity, high melting point and easy processing are required, such as copper, graphite, copper-tungsten alloy and molybdenum. During processing, the tool electrode and the product are lost at the same time, but it is less than the amount of removal of the workpiece metal, and it can be ignored when it is close to 0.
Coolant: As a discharge medium, it plays the role of cooling and chip removal during processing. The requirement for coolant is a medium with low viscosity, high flash point and stable, such as kerosene, deionized water and emulsion, etc.
After the pulse voltage is applied between the two electrodes, when there is an appropriate gap between the workpiece and the electrode, the current will break down the coolant medium between the workpiece and the tool electrode, and a connected discharge channel will appear.

 

The discharge channel generates high temperature instantaneously, which melts and even vaporizes the surface of the workpiece, and also vaporizes the coolant medium, which rapidly shrinks at the discharge gap and explodes. etch pits.


After the pulse discharge is completed, return to a safe distance to restore the insulation of the coolant. In this way, the pulse voltage acts on the workpiece and the tool electrode repeatedly, the above-mentioned reaction process continues, and the surface of the workpiece is gradually etched away.

 

The servo machine continuously adjusts the absolute distance between the tool electrode and the workpiece, and automatically feeds it to ensure the normal operation of the pulse discharge until the parts of the required size are processed.


1. CNC die sinking edm process
The tool electrode is usually a copper or graphite shaped electrode, which can be of all shapes that can be manufactured, and the processed shape is the corresponding cavity.

 

2. Wire cut machine process
Electrical discharge machine wire cut edm processing is divided into brass wire and molybdenum wire. The wire diameter uses electrode wire with a diameter of 0.1mm~0.3mm to process the straight-grained surface parts, which can be punch parts or die holes.

 

3. Drill edm process

A thin tube (>Φ0.3mm) electrode is used, and the high pressure water-based working fluid is flushed into the tube; the thin tube electrode rotates; the perforation speed is very high (30~60mm/min); starting hole of wire cutting edm; large depth-diameter ratio Small holes, such as nozzles, etc.;
